How Far Away Is Mercury Away From The Sun

Mercury, the smallest planet in our solar system, has always been a subject of fascination due to its proximity to the Sun. Understanding how far away Mercury is from the Sun is not only interesting but also useful for astronomers and space enthusiasts alike.

The distance between Mercury and the Sun is approximately 58 million kilometers, which is relatively close compared to other planets. This proximity is one of the reasons why Mercury is a hot planet with extremely high temperatures during the day.
